Right before Burning Man last year, I decided to bust out a glow stick (blue to be specific). I was swishing it back and forth across our bed as 16lb. damn cat bit the glow stick. As he does this I can see the liquid shoot down his throat and then all over his face. I freaked :shock: ! I know it says non toxic on the packaging but things that are non toxic to people aren't neccessarily for animals. Of course it's about 10pm. So I finally got a hold of someone at our local emergency vet. I'm in a panic that I've killed my damn cat from something as stupid as this. (By this time kitty is running around the house like a maniac foaming horribly from the mouth, oh and his whole face is glowing a magical blue, along with the carpet and comforter!) I told the lady what we were up to and she started laughing hysterically :lol: as I'm telling her this, damn cat has managed to lodge his porky body behind the couch. Looking behind the couch all I could see was a bright blue nose and whiskers and the sound of growling kitty discontent. Needless to say, glow stick juice just tastes really bad to damn cats and that is why they foam at the mouth, so for future reference, glow stick juice will not kill your animals. :wink:

How much is too much?
The toxic dose of Theobromine (and caffeine) for pets is 100-200mg/kg. (1 kiliogram = 2.2 pounds). However, various reports by the ASPCA (American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als) have noted problems at doses much lower than this - i.e. 20mg/kg.

Translated to a "typical" scenario, and using the 20mg/kg as a measure of "problems can be seen at this level of ingestion", a 50 pound dog would have to consume 9 ounces (+/-) of milk chocolate to consume the 20mg/kg amount of Theobromine. Some dogs won't see problems at this rate. Some may.

This is a much more conservative toxic level calculation than the "standard" of 100-200mg/kg, but better safe than sorry. A dog sneaking a couple M&M's shouldn't have a problem, but it isn't a good habit to get into!
